Common Marketing Challenges Addressed by Robotic Process Automation

Marketing managers often face operational hurdles that slow campaign success. RPA directly tackles these challenges by automating routine, rule-based tasks:

  • Attribution Complexity: Assigning accurate credit across multiple channels and touchpoints is critical yet challenging for precise ROI measurement.
  • Manual Data Entry: Transferring lead data between platforms is time-consuming and prone to errors.
  • Lead Qualification Delays: Slow follow-up reduces conversion rates and diminishes campaign effectiveness.
  • Campaign Feedback Lag: Collecting and acting on real-time customer insights remains difficult.
  • Workflow Inconsistencies: Disconnected tools and manual handoffs create bottlenecks and inefficiencies.

Attribution refers to identifying which marketing channels or campaigns contribute to a lead or sale.

RPA automates these repetitive tasks, enabling faster, more accurate lead processing. For example, bots can instantly capture lead information from web forms and input it into CRM systems, eliminating manual errors and accelerating lead qualification. Additionally, RPA integrates data across platforms, providing unified insights that simplify attribution and optimize campaigns.

Understanding the Robotic Process Automation Framework for Marketing

A structured RPA framework is essential for successful automation deployment in marketing workflows. It ensures alignment with business objectives and maximizes return on investment.

Robotic Process Automation (RPA) involves software bots performing repetitive, rule-based tasks traditionally handled by humans, improving speed, accuracy, and scalability.

Core Stages of the RPA Framework

Stage Description Marketing Example
Process Identification Discover repetitive, high-volume tasks in lead workflows. Data entry from landing pages, email follow-ups.
Feasibility Assessment Analyze task complexity and automation potential. Evaluating if lead scoring rules can be automated.
Bot Development Design and program bots tailored to marketing systems. Creating bots to sync leads from Facebook Ads to CRM.
Testing & Validation Ensure bots perform accurately and handle exceptions. Simulating lead data inputs and error scenarios.
Deployment Integrate bots into production with minimal disruption. Launching bots during low campaign activity periods.
Monitoring & Optimization Track performance and refine workflows continuously. Adjusting bot logic based on lead conversion feedback.

This framework mitigates risks and ensures automation delivers measurable improvements in campaign efficiency.


Key Components of Robotic Process Automation in Marketing

To build an effective RPA ecosystem, marketers need to understand its essential components:

Component Description Marketing Application Example
Bot Software Scripts or programs executing automated tasks. Extracting lead data from web forms into CRM automatically.
Orchestration Layer Central platform managing bot schedules, exceptions, and workflows. Running bots during peak campaign hours and handling errors.
User Interface (UI) Automation Bots simulate human interactions with websites, emails, or CRM interfaces. Auto-filling contact forms and sending personalized emails.
Integration APIs Connectors enabling seamless data flow between marketing tools and systems. Syncing lead data from Google Ads to Salesforce CRM.
Analytics & Reporting Dashboards tracking bot performance, lead metrics, and campaign ROI. Real-time reports on lead response times and attribution data.

Together, these components create a robust automation infrastructure that streamlines lead management and follow-up processes.


Step-by-Step Guide to Implementing Robotic Process Automation in Lead Generation and Follow-Up

A systematic approach ensures successful RPA implementation:

Step 1: Identify Automation Opportunities

Map your lead generation and follow-up workflows. Target repetitive, rule-driven tasks such as data entry, lead scoring, email sequencing, and reporting.

Step 2: Prioritize by Impact and Feasibility

Rank processes based on volume, error rates, and complexity. For example, automating lead capture from web forms often delivers quick, high-impact wins.

Step 3: Select the Right RPA Tools

Choose platforms compatible with your marketing stack. Popular RPA tools like UiPath, Automation Anywhere, and Blue Prism offer strong CRM and analytics integrations.

Step 4: Design Detailed Bot Workflows

Document every bot action, including data inputs, decision logic, exception handling, and outputs. For example, a bot may extract lead info, check for duplicates, score leads, and trigger follow-up emails.

Step 5: Develop and Test Bots

Build bots in a controlled environment. Test extensively with diverse datasets and gather stakeholder feedback to ensure accuracy and reliability.

Step 6: Deploy and Monitor

Measuring Robotic Process Automation Success in Marketing

Tracking clear KPIs aligned with marketing goals is essential to evaluate RPA impact and justify investments:

KPI Definition Measurement Method Target Metrics for Marketing Teams
Lead Processing Time Time from lead capture to CRM entry and qualification CRM and automation platform timestamps Reduce by 30-50% within 3 months
Lead Conversion Rate Percentage of leads converting to Marketing Qualified Leads (MQLs) or customers CRM pipeline and attribution analytics Increase by 10-20% after automation
Campaign Attribution Accuracy Accuracy of channel credit assignment in attribution platforms Cross-checks of RPA logs and attribution reports Improve by reducing manual errors
Follow-up Engagement Rate Percentage of leads responding to automated follow-up communications Email platform open and click-through rates Increase by 15-25%
Data Entry Error Rate Frequency of incorrect or missing lead data entries Data validation audits in CRM Target near-zero critical errors

Regularly reviewing these KPIs helps marketers optimize RPA workflows and demonstrate value.

Minimizing Risks When Deploying Robotic Process Automation in Marketing

Proactively addressing risks safeguards marketing operations and ensures successful automation adoption:

  • Data Privacy Compliance: Enforce GDPR, CCPA, and other regulations by implementing role-based access and encrypted data handling.
  • Bot Failure Handling: Build exception management to flag issues without disrupting workflows.
  • Change Management: Communicate automation impacts clearly to teams, fostering adoption and minimizing resistance.
  • Security Measures: Use secure credential storage and encrypted communication channels for bot access.
  • Avoid Over-Automation: Reserve tasks requiring human judgment, like complex lead qualification, for manual review.

Pilot testing, continuous monitoring, and cross-functional collaboration are critical to mitigating these risks.

FAQ: Robotic Process Automation for Lead Generation and Follow-Up

What is the first step to automate lead generation with RPA?

Begin by mapping your existing lead generation workflow, identifying repetitive tasks like manual data entry or campaign tagging, and prioritize those with high volume and error rates for automation.

How does RPA improve attribution accuracy in marketing campaigns?

RPA automates data synchronization between marketing channels and attribution platforms, reducing manual errors and delivering unified, accurate reporting on channel performance.

Which KPIs are essential to track RPA success?

Focus on lead processing time, lead conversion rates, campaign attribution accuracy, follow-up engagement rates, and data entry error rates.

How can I ensure RPA bots comply with data privacy regulations?

Implement strict access controls, encrypt sensitive data, audit bot activities regularly, and stay current on regulations such as GDPR and CCPA.

Can RPA handle personalized customer follow-ups?

Yes. Bots can trigger personalized emails or messages based on lead behavior and segmentation, enabling timely, relevant engagement at scale.
